Here Are The Young Men: Radiohead’s Kid A
Barney Hoskyns, Rock's Backpages, December 2000
2000 WAS PARTLY about waiting for Yorko: waiting for the follow-up to the huge, incandescent, panoramic, faux-pomp OK Computer. And when Kid A finally arrived its message seemed to be no more than WE ARE NOT A ROCK GROUP. No guitars, no R.E.M./U2 stadium-rock-with-IQs guitar anthemics. Live, the bands new Warped avant-pop sat uneasily alongside the crunching Bends rockers and the Computer lamentations.
